Control device and control method for a digital signal in a multiple access data communications system

A variation on a carrier sense multiple access/collision detection (CSMA/CD) system protocol for local area, packet, random access, broadcast networks for effectively servicing both voice and data traffic. When the instant method is used, a mix of periodic voice traffic and aperiodic data traffic can be transmitted on a channel without the voice packets colliding. Also, an upper bound on the delay experienced by the periodic traffic can be established. In the instant method, aperiodic source contend for a channel as in conventional CSMA/CD networks. However, unlike conventional protocols, periodic sources transmit a preempt field, responsive to which aperiodic sources terminate transmission. Also unlike conventional protocols, a periodic "time slot" may be delayed up to one packet transmission time when the network is busy transmitting aperiodic data. Additional information can be transmitted in a overflow field so that a receiver can supply periodic samples at regular intervals with the advantageous result of obviating discontinuities in a reconstructed analog speech waveform. Also unlike conventional CSMA/CD networks, the system capacity can be fully utilized by periodic sources. Still further, the instant method contemplates a system with no centralized control to assign "time slots" or to reallocate capacity between periodic and aperodic sources. In addition, movable time slots allow timing discrepancies between periodic sources to be tolerated.
